
Thyroid cancer is a type of cancer that develops when the cells that make up the thyroid gland undergo changes and transform into cancerous cells.
The majority of thyroid cancers are detected either as a palpable mass in the neck or through examinations and tests revealing nodules within the thyroid.
These nodules can vary in size, ranging from very small to encompassing the entire thyroid gland. Depending on whether the nodules secrete hormones or not, they are classified as hormone-active (hot) or hormone-inactive (cold). The likelihood of cancer is higher in hormone-inactive (cold) nodules compared to hormone-active (hot) nodules.
Following a fine-needle aspiration biopsy of the identified thyroid nodules, it is determined whether they are cancerous or not. Subsequently, the treatment is organized based on the diagnosis.
Thyroid cancers are typically diagnosed through fine needle aspiration biopsy of suspicious nodules detected during examinations and tests. Additionally, a diagnosis can be made based on masses in the neck noticed by patients themselves.
Thyroid cancers can manifest in various sizes and may be accompanied by symptoms such as difficulty breathing, difficulty swallowing, hoarseness, and neck pain. Any patient presenting with such symptoms should undergo examination and testing to determine whether these symptoms are attributable to thyroid cancer or not."
When diagnosed, thyroid cancer is a treatable disease with the correct treatment. However, if neglected by patients or if there is a delay in diagnosis, the cancer can initially spread to the neck lymph nodes. In such cases, beyond thyroid surgery, neck dissection may be added to the surgery, requiring the removal of lymph nodes in the neck.
In more advanced cases, metastasis to distant organs can occur. It is known that this spread (metastasis) not only complicates the patient's treatment but also shortens their lifespan. Therefore, thyroid cancer, which can be fully cured after surgery when diagnosed and treated promptly, can become more challenging to treat and may shorten the patient's life if there is a delay.
Thyroid cancer is a type of cancer that can metastasize if left untreated or if there is a delay in treatment. In thyroid cancers, a common site of metastasis is the neck lymph nodes.
If thyroid cancers are not treated or if there is a delay in treatment, distant organ metastases can occur. Distant organ metastasis is a significant factor that affects the patient's life. Metastases to distant organs are most commonly observed in organs such as the lungs, bones, and brain.
While thyroid cancer is a treatable disease when diagnosed and surgically treated, if left untreated, the disease can progress, leading to the spread of the cancer to neck lymph nodes and subsequently to distant organs (metastasis). This progression can shorten the lifespan of the thyroid cancer patient.
The most significant factors contributing to the loss of thyroid cancer patients are distant organ metastases observed after untreated thyroid cancer.
